Transaction 901e0246e07dc39b25261c8f60308eeaef71d2090a73d5aa5bd5a1fa5e86b692

1 Input
2 Outputs
  • 901e0246e07dc39b25261c8f60308eeaef71d2090a73d5aa5bd5a1fa5e86b692:0
  • value  580000
    address  1G2CHTSfUXqqvHUKAuXGtiHCDaCYWRLXU1
  • 901e0246e07dc39b25261c8f60308eeaef71d2090a73d5aa5bd5a1fa5e86b692:1
  • value  5815536
    address  1EjSphTVdB5GQZbWpipAbKdTrSNer7H94y